Finland announces Russia will cut off gas delivery on Saturday.

“On the afternoon of Friday May 20, Gazprom Export informed Gasum that natural gas supplies to Finland under Gasum’s supply contract will be cut on Saturday May 21, 2022 at 07.00,” Gasum, Finland’s state-owned gas wholesaler, said Friday.

Finland has refused to pay for gas in Rubles, as Russia demanded, and has moved toward joining NATO, against Russia’s wishes.

Gasum’s CEO, Mika Wiljanen, said they have been prepared for such an eventuality, and, “… provided that there will be no disruptions in the gas transmission network, we will be able to supply all our customers with gas in the coming months. Gasum will supply natural gas to its customers from other sources through the Balticconnector pipeline. Gasum’s gas filling stations in the gas network area will continue in normal operation”
